Karl Lashley

A psychologist and behaviorist known for his contributions to the study of learning and memory.

Self-Reference Effect

A phenomenon where individuals are more likely to remember information related to themselves, due to its personal relevance.

Deep Processing

A method of processing information that involves engaging with the material on a meaningful level, rather than on a superficial or rote basis.

Massed Practice

A learning technique involving concentrated, continuous practice or study over a short period of time, as opposed to spreading out learning over a longer period.
